CBI Clears Rhea Chakraborty in Sushant Singh Rajput Case: 5 Key Findings from Closure Report

The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) has given a clean chit to actor Rhea Chakraborty in the death case of late actor Sushant Singh Rajput, stating there is no evidence to suggest she “illegally confined, threatened, or abetted” the actor’s suicide.


Sushant’s family, however, expressed dissatisfaction with the report, calling it incomplete and insufficient.


1. Rhea Left Sushant’s Flat on June 8, 2020

The report states that Rhea and her brother Showik left Rajput’s Bandra flat on June 8. They did not return afterward. Between June 8 and June 14, Sushant did not communicate with Rhea or her family, except a single WhatsApp message to Showik on June 10.


2. Sushant’s Sister Stayed Till June 12

Sushant’s sister, Meetu Singh, stayed with him from June 8 to June 12. His manager, Shruti Modi, had not visited the flat since February due to a leg injury.


3. Rhea Took Personal Gifts

The CBI clarified that Rhea took her Apple laptop and wristwatch, gifts from Sushant, when she left. There was no evidence that any other property was removed dishonestly.


4. Sushant Considered Rhea Part of the Family

The report noted that Rhea and Sushant were in a live-in relationship from April 2019 to June 2020. Sushant’s finances were handled by his accountant and lawyer. He considered Rhea part of the family. Therefore, any expenses on her were legitimate and not deceitful.


5. Alleged Threats Were Hearsay

The CBI found no evidence that Rhea or others threatened Sushant. Claims about medical records were hearsay. There was no supporting proof in digital or physical records.


Conclusion

The closure report states that there is no evidence of abetment, coercion, or illegal confinement by Rhea Chakraborty or others.

The Patna court will next hear the closure report on December 20, 2025.
